CTL Conversation: Teaching in the Time of The Ukraine War

March 8, 2022 @ 1:00 pm 2:00 pm EST

Russia’s declaration of war on Ukraine on February 24, 2022 marked the first time a European state has been invaded by another since the Second World War, unleashed a humanitarian crisis and heightened the international nuclear threat. What does this situation mean for us as the Baruch community? How can we be more cognizant of those of us–among faculty, students and staff–who are affected by the crisis and exhibit more empathy? What are reputable sources where we can find out about what is happening–and what can we do to help?

CTL Conversations offer faculty and staff a time to come together to virtually and informally workshop, brainstorm, and discuss topics related to teaching, with different topics each week.
